Healthcare professionals are constantly interfacing with potentially hazardous materials and infectious agents. It is imperative that they have access to the best possible personal protective equipment (PPE) to safeguard themselves and their patients. Nitrile gloves, a type of synthetic glove made from acrylonitrile-butadiene rubber, have emerged as the gold standard for protection in healthcare settings.
These versatile gloves offer exceptional barrier properties, effectively shielding against a wide range of pathogens, chemicals, and sharps. Nitrile's superior strength and durability make them less prone to puncturing compared to latex or vinyl gloves. This enhanced protection is crucial for preventing the spread of infection and ensuring the well-being of both healthcare providers and patients.
- Furthermore, nitrile gloves are hypoallergenic, making them a suitable choice for individuals with latex allergies.
- In addition to their protective qualities, nitrile gloves provide excellent grip and tactile sensitivity, allowing for precise handling of instruments and materials.
As a result, nitrile gloves have become an indispensable component of infection control protocols in hospitals, clinics, and other healthcare facilities. By providing a reliable barrier against potential hazards, these gloves play a critical role in protecting the health and safety of everyone involved in the delivery of care.

Choosing the Perfect Match for Your's Nitrile Gloves
Ensuring a proper fit when wearing nitrile gloves is paramount for both protection and comfort.
A glove that is too small can restrict movement, increase hand fatigue, and even lead to tears in the material. Alternatively, a glove that's too large can cause bunching, slipping, and compromise the integrity of your barrier against chemicals.
- To determine the right size for you, take measurements the circumference of your hand at its widest point, typically just above the knuckles.
- Check the manufacturer's sizing chart for corresponding glove sizes based on these measurements.
- Remember that some manufacturers may use different sizing systems.
- If uncertain, it's always best to size up rather than down.
